We would like to welcome you all to the homepage of the 1st Cold Shock Protein Symposium (CSPS). Until now there has been no informal platform to exchange ideas/exciting news, present talks and posters on cold shock protein research.
Therefore it is our quest to bring together the community by initiating a meeting on COLD SHOCK PROTEINS.
The first meeting will take place in Magdeburg (Germany) a historic city located on the river Elbe, residing in the center of a triangle formed by Berlin, Hannover, and Leipzig. Information on transportation and registration details are provided in this webpage.

We have received numerous positive responses and are pleased to announce that we are expecting more than 30 senior scientists from the cold shock protein community. The field of participants will be completed with postdocs and PhD students, so we will be more than 60 scientists in total.
The format of the meeting is as follows: the meeting will start on the afternoon of Thursday, September 12th with a key note lecture. There will be scientific sessions on Friday, September 13th and Saturday, September 14th.
Cultural and networking events will complete the symposium. On Friday evening we have planned a relaxed boat tour on the river Elbe including dinner. Saturday afternoon we will use bicycles to explore the area around Magdeburg, before we will finish the first Cold Shock Protein Meeting with a BBQ and live music in the evening.
